Explanation
 
BACKGROUND:                                          
 
Need: This ordinance authorizes the Safety Director to enter into an agreement for a civilian canine trainer for the Division of Police. This service is needed to keep our canines astute, accurate and credible, thereby maximizing performance while limiting liability.
 
Bid Information: Dan Bowman of Gold Shield Canine Training, LTD will provide eight hours of in-house canine training a week at a cost of $87.25 per hour. Since Dan Bowman has trained our new canines since 1993, and we still would like to keep him as a trainer, competitive bidding must be waived.
 
Contract Compliance No.: 311759733 is Gold Shield Canine Training, LTD's number.
 
FISCAL IMPACT:
 
Funds are budgeted in the Division's 2004 General Fund Budget for these services. Thirty Nine Thousand Seven Hundred Eighty Six ($39,786.00) was encumbered in 2003 for the trainer.
 
Title
 
To authorize and direct the Safety Director to enter into an agreement for the training of canines for the Division of Police, to waive the City Code provision of competitive bidding, to authorize the expenditure of $39,786.00 from the General Fund. ($39,786.00)
 
Body
 
WHEREAS, the Division of Police needs to have all their canines trained on a weekly basis; and
 
WHEREAS, Gold Shield Canine Training, LTD will provide eight hours in-house canine training per week; and
 
WHEREAS, Gold Shield Canine Training, LTD have trained all of the Division's Canines since 1993; and
 
WHEREAS, it is necessary to waive the provision of Section 329.06 of the Columbus City codes, 1959; now therefore
 
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S:
 
Section 1. That the Public Safety Director be and hereby authorized and directed to enter into an agreement with Gold Shield Canine Training, LTD for the weekly training of the Division of Police's canines.
 
Section 2. That the expenditure of $39,786.00 or so much thereof as may be needed, be and the same is hereby authorized as follows:

Section 3. That the provisions of Section 329.06 of the Columbus City Codes, 1959 are hereby waived.
 
Section 4. That this ordinance shall take effect and be in force from and after the earliest period allow by law.
